Top Baccarat Bonuses and Promotions: What to Look For

Baccarat is a very popular card game that originated within Italy and has captured the attention of players from all over the world. Its simplicity and elegance make it a staple in casinos both in physical and online. With the rise of digital gambling, players are looking for direct websites that can provide Baccarat that… Continue reading Top Baccarat Bonuses and Promotions: What to Look For